Lynda Faye Caldwell

December 12, 1946 — June 1, 2022

Lynda FayE Caldwell was a loving and generous mother, grandmother, sister, and friend. She left this world unexpectedly on June 1, 2022. She was born in Emporia Kansas on December 12, 1946 to Kenneth and Delpha Croucher both deceased. She is survived by her brothers Donald Leon Croucher (Pamala Ann), James Richard Croucher (Gaylene), and Eldon Ray Croucher. A sister Judy K Croucher deceased. As a child, she was a free spirit. She would run the country roads, help on her grandparents' farm, and care for orphaned wild animals. Lynda loved riding and jumping her horse, Dutchess. Her two shepherds (Sheba and Fang) were her companions and protectors. She married David M. Caldwell in 1966. And are survived by 3 children Albert Wayne Caldwell (Shannon Joy), Jane Clarice Leger (Thomas Edward Jr.), and David Grant Caldwell. She later divorced in 1987. Lynda devoted her life to caring for her children and family. She later was able to enjoy and is survived by her grandchildren. Laura Leigh Holland, Caitlin Ashley Manual (Gabriel), Sarah Nicole Smith (Gordon), Ashley Lynn Barrett (Jamie), Jerrith Michael Caldwell, Drake Thomas Leger, Chelsea Lynne Caldwell, Emily Jane Leger, Hope Noelle Caldwell, and Karen Richelle Bailey. As well as great-grandchildren, Rhyleigh Nicole Barrett, Harleigh Faye Barrett, Jaymeigh Lynn Barrett, Anastasia Grace Williams, Legacy Ann Smith, Ezreal Thomas Leger, Elliana Rey Manuel, and Londynn Jane Smith, and many nieces and nephews. Lynda will be missed by many. She did not want any funeral services. At a later date, a celebration of her life will be held. Requiescet in pace.
